Abstract

An attempt has been made to achieve the changes in the selectivity performance of a highly frequency selective crystal network in the high frequency range using degenerative capacitive voltage feedback so that a minor change in bandwidth and center frequency can be obtained using the given technique. The capacitive feedback can be varied to achieve the changes in the center frequencies as well as the selective bandwidths. Usually this type of feedback is not popular because of its bad features of instability. In the present case the same feature with some modification has been utilized to ascertain the stability of the network.
